To boost digital transactions, the RBI has done away with all the charges on fund transfer via RTGS and NEFT. With this step, customers will have to shell out lower charges for fund transfer from today i.e. July 1.
The RBI has asked the member banks to pass on the transfer of this waiver to bank customers on an immediate basis.
RTGS And NEFT Fund Transfer Charges To Be Reduced From Today
NEFT is used for transfer of funds aggregating up to Rs. 2 lakh while RTGS is for high-valued transactions of over Rs. 2 lakh.
Also, the RBI has decided that from today time varying and processing charges levied by the central bank on member banks for outward transactions via the RTGS and the processing charges for transactions carried out via NEFT will be done away.
